Provenance verification now locks to published tarballs

Provenance checks now compare attestations against the exact uploaded tarball hash, preventing mismatched-byte verification.

Provenance verification now checks the published tarball bytes

The publish flow now stores the SHA-256 of the uploaded tarball, and provenance verification compares an attestation’s subject.digest.sha256 against that exact publish-time hash. This closes a gap where a valid attestation could be incorrectly matched to the wrong package bytes, and verification now fails closed if the hash is missing.
